Crinetics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(NASDAQ: CRNX), a trailblazer in the biotechnology sector, is making waves with its promising drug pipeline and substantial potential upside. The company’s market cap is currently valued at $3.09 billion, and its focus on rare endocrine diseases and endocrine-related tumors positions it as a compelling opportunity for investors seeking growth in the healthcare sector.

Currently trading at $33.02, Crinetics Pharmaceuticals has experienced a minor price change of 0.03% recently. However, the stock’s 52-week range from $25.56 to $60.69 indicates a history of volatility, yet also a capacity for significant growth. The forward-looking potential is what truly stands out, with analyst ratings reflecting a bullish sentiment. Out of 17 analyst ratings, 16 advocate a “Buy,” while only one suggests a “Hold,” and none recommend selling. The average target price of $72.67 suggests a noteworthy potential upside of 120.07%, a figure that demands attention from growth-oriented investors.

Despite the promising outlook, Crinetics is not without its challenges. The company’s financial metrics reflect the inherent risks of investing in a clinical-stage pharmaceutical venture. With a negative EPS of -3.80 and a return on equity of -30.84%, the firm is yet to achieve profitability. Additionally, a negative revenue growth rate of -43.60% and free cash flow of -$155.77 million highlight the financial pressures typical of companies in the R&D-intensive biotechnology industry.

The absence of earnings metrics such as P/E and PEG ratios, along with a negative forward P/E of -7.17, underscores the company’s current focus on investment in future growth over immediate returns. Crinetics does not distribute dividends, maintaining a payout ratio of 0.00%, which aligns with its strategy of reinvesting capital into advancing its drug pipeline.

Crinetics’ product pipeline is diverse and promising. Its lead candidate, Paltusotine, is in Phase 3 trials for treating acromegaly and carcinoid syndrome, while other candidates like Atumelnant and CRN09682 show potential in addressing various endocrine disorders. The partnerships with Sanwa Kagaku Kenkyusho Co., Ltd, and Cellular Longevity, Inc. to develop and commercialize its products internationally further bolster its growth prospects.
